Internal Plugins (Claim Digger / Schedule Comparison, Update Baseline, XML Export/Import) Fail to Run When Utilizing P6 Professional Cloud Connect with SSL (HTTPS) Integration API Server URL

Symptoms
ACTUAL BEHAVIOR
Internal Plugins fail to launch when P6 Professional is configured for cloud connect and communicating through Secure Sockets Layer (SSL) protocol - Hypertext Transfer Protocol Secure (HTTPS) - for the Cloud Connect Uniform Resource Locator (URL) and Remote Mode Application Programming Interface (API) URL.
Internal Plugin Results:
- Running Claim Digger / Schedule Comparison produces a login box prompt
- Running Update Baseline produces "An Application event has been intercepted. Please note the event code for reference. Event Code DFE2354C (note, the Event Code string can vary)
- Running P6 XML Export produces "Export failed. See log file for details."
- Running P6 XML Import produces "Cannot schedule job. Please contact administrator to correct the problem."
- Running MS Project XML Export produces "Process completed with errors. See log file for details."
- Running MS Project XML Import produces "Cannot schedule job. Please contact administrator to correct the problem."
EXPECTED BEHAVIOR
For Internal Plugins to succeed when connected over SSL protocol for the Cloud Connect and Remote Mode API URLs.
STEPS
The issue can be reproduced at will with the following steps:
- Configure P6 EPPM Remote mode API and Cloud Connect for SSL.
- Configure the P6 Remote Mode API URL for the SSL connection in P6 Administration --> Application Settings --> General.
- Configure P6 Professional to connect to cloud connect over SSL protocol
- Login to P6 Professional, launch Claim Digger and note the error which occurs (also note the errors which can occur with other Internal Plugins)
